3. Law and sympathy are not one and the same. But, law cannot be substituted for sympathy. Administration of justice must be justice according to law. That will be legal justice.
4. A commission or omission as prescribed under the penal law alone will be an offence. Certain illegalities, wrongful acts, omissions may be immoral. But such immoral activities may not be illegal. A married woman having connection with another man is immoral. It is adultery. But, it is not an offence so far as a woman is concerned. But, for the man, it is an offence. Failure to help a drowning man, put out fire in a burning house may be a wicked act but it is not an offence.
